hello im a new user here! was looking for help in finding production numbers for the 90 buick lesabre, specifically for the 2 door that i own. was told they built less than 2000 coupes that year. i never saw many, even back in the day. any help is appreciated. this spring i plan to yank the stock 3800 (165 horse i think) and drop in a supercharged 3800 from a 96 park ave ultra (220 horse if i recall).

kind of reminds me of the LeSabre T-Type......but those were made from '87-'89....they were two door beauties....

Putting in a OBD II engine in an OBD I car means changing, ECM to PCM, new wiring harnesses, and that tranny in the '90 won't be compatible....
